Achieving Work-Life Balance: Tips for a Healthier You

In today’s fast-paced world, finding a balance between work and personal life can feel like an elusive goal. With the demands of our jobs often spilling over into our personal time, it’s essential to establish boundaries and prioritize our well-being. Here are some practical tips to help you achieve a healthier work-life balance.

  1. Set Clear Boundaries

    Establishing boundaries is crucial. Define your working hours and stick to them. Communicate these boundaries to your colleagues and supervisors to manage expectations. When work hours are over, disconnect from work-related emails and messages.

  2. Prioritize Your Tasks

    Use tools like to-do lists or productivity apps to prioritize tasks. Focus on high-impact activities that align with your goals. Learn to say no to tasks that don’t serve your objectives or that may overwhelm your schedule.

  3. Embrace Flexibility

    If your job allows for it, consider flexible work arrangements. Whether it’s remote work or adjusted hours, flexibility can significantly enhance your ability to juggle work and personal commitments.

  4. Schedule Downtime

    Just as you schedule meetings and deadlines, schedule time for yourself. Whether it’s a short walk, a workout, or time spent with loved ones, prioritize these moments to recharge your mind and body.

  5. Practice Mindfulness

    Incorporating mindfulness practices, such as meditation or deep-breathing exercises, can help you stay present and reduce stress. Even a few minutes a day can make a significant difference in your overall well-being.

  6. Foster Supportive Relationships

    Cultivate relationships both at work and outside of it. A supportive network can provide encouragement and help you navigate challenges, making it easier to maintain balance.

  7. Pursue Hobbies

    Engaging in hobbies and activities you love can provide a much-needed escape from work stress. Whether it’s painting, gardening, or playing a sport, finding time for passion projects is essential for your mental health.

  8. Reflect and Adjust

    Regularly assess your work-life balance. Are you feeling overwhelmed? Are you neglecting personal relationships? Reflection helps you identify areas for adjustment and ensures you stay aligned with your values.

  9. Seek Professional Help if Needed

    If you find it difficult to achieve balance despite your efforts, consider seeking help from a professional. Therapists and coaches can provide valuable strategies tailored to your situation.

  10. Remember: It’s a Journey

    Work-life balance isn’t a one-time achievement; it’s an ongoing process. Be patient with yourself as you navigate the ups and downs. Adjust your strategies as needed and celebrate small victories along the way.
